An ionic bond or electrovalent bond is an electrostatic attraction where one atom donates an electron to another atom. The transfer results in the atom that loses an electron become a positively charged ion or cation , while the atom gaining the electron becomes a negatively charged ion or anion. But, the net charge on an ionic compound is zero neutral. This type of chemical bond occurs between atoms with very differently electronegativity values, such as metals and nonmetals or various molecular ions. Ionic bonding is one of the main types of chemical bonding, together with covalent bonding and metallic bonding. The classic example of an ionic bond is the chemical bond that forms between sodium and chlorine atoms, forming sodium chloride NaCl.

As you have learned, ions are atoms or molecules bearing an electrical charge. A cation a positive ion forms when a neutral atom loses one or more electrons from its valence shell, and an anion a negative ion forms when a neutral atom gains one or more electrons in its valence shell. Compounds composed of ions are called ionic compounds or salts , and their constituent ions are held together by ionic bonds : electrostatic forces of attraction between oppositely charged cations and anions. The properties of ionic compounds shed some light on the nature of ionic bonds. Ionic solids exhibit a crystalline structure and tend to be rigid and brittle; they also tend to have high melting and boiling points, which suggests that ionic bonds are very strong. Ionic solids are also poor conductors of electricity for the same reason—the strength of ionic bonds prevents ions from moving freely in the solid state. Most ionic solids, however, dissolve readily in water. Once dissolved or melted, ionic compounds are excellent conductors of electricity and heat because the ions can move about freely.
